The company was founded in November 1972 as Green Shield Stamps catalogue shops, and rebranded to Argos in 1973. The name Argos is derived from the Greek city Argos that is famous for its rich history. Savings bonds and stamps were the main products of the company initially. Later, the company expanded into jewellery and watches. In 1980, the company introduced its Elizabeth Duke jewellery counters, named after a director's wife.

Due to its growth, the Argos brand has gained recognition in the United Kingdom. It is the third-largest retailer in the country, and has a significant presence in online sales. In addition the company offers an extensive range of retail locations across England, Scotland, Wales and Northern Ireland. The company is a limited company that is listed on the London Stock Exchange.

TK Maxx has some incredible bargains, but it is important to be aware of where to look. For example the numbers on a tag constitute a "cheat code" that informs shoppers whether an product is a bargain. A Channel 5 documentary recently revealed that a number 2 means "genuine surplus stock." Similar to that, a number 4 means that the item is a limited-time line designed exclusively for TK Maxx.
